Formula E to race on full Monaco F1 circuit for 2021 E-Prix

The FIA has announced Formula E will race on the ꦰfull Monaco Formula 1 Grand Prix circuit ꦇfor May’s E-Prix.

For the first time in Formula E’s history, 🌃it will race on the𓃲 full 19-turn, 3.32km Monaco circuit.

In the pﷺrevious three visits to Monaco, Formula E has raced on a shortened layout, where drivers turned right before Massenet, whi♏le Mirabeau, the hairpin and the famous Monaco tunnel were cut out completely.

It won’t be completely identical to the F1 circuit as the kerbs at Sainte Devote and the Nouvelle chica🃏ne have been adjusted.

Speaking of the announcement, FIA president Jean Todt said: “I’m glad to see the ABB FIA Formula E World Championship b✃ack in the Principality.

“It is in the series’ DNA to compete on streets circuits and Monaco is one of the most iconic tracks in th🧸e world. This discipline has its own identity, that’s why, together with 🧜Formula E and the ACM, we’ve designed a bespoke layout which suits its particularities.”

Formula E chief championship officer, Alberto Longo, added: “To see Formula E race around the longer veꦇrsion of the most historic racing circuit in the world will mark another great milestone for the ABB FIA Formula E World Championship.

“In many ways, this circuit isꦓ made for Formula E – it’s a fast and narrow street circuit which will see plenty of opport💞unities for overtaking and will really test driver’s energy management with sharp inclines and high-speed sections.

“The FIA and the ACM are allowing us to race around corners steeped in motorsport tradition and we are honoured that Form🐭ula E will be creating its own history on May 8.”

The 2021 Monaco E-Prix is set to take place on May 8, while Formula 1’s Monaco GP will ✨take place on May 23.
